Responsibilities

Coordinate efforts to negotiate property sale between buyer and seller to achieve desired results

Turn prospective homebuyers into qualified leads by continuously following up and facilitating communication and adding them to the sales pipeline

Prepare representation contracts, purchase agreements, closing statements, deeds, and leases for clients to facilitate a smooth transaction

Search for prospective homebuyers and present them with information on homes that fit their needs and budget

Have open houses to build relationships with prospective homebuyers and introduce them to their local real estate market

Qualifications

Has superb interpersonal and communication skills

Applicants should have a high school diploma, bachelor’s degree desired

Show a track record of real estate success

Possess a valid U.S. driver’s license and can travel by car

Real estate license required
